Engine Torque Specifications
When it comes to your engine, precision is key. Getting the torque specs right can be the difference between a smooth-running engine and a costly repair. Cylinder head bolts, for example, require a specific torque sequence and value to ensure proper sealing and compression. Typically, these are tightened in multiple stages, gradually increasing the torque to the final specification. For the 2000 Honda Civic EX, the cylinder head bolts usually require a multi-step torque process. You'll want to consult your repair manual for the exact sequence and torque values, but a common approach is to tighten them to around 22 ft-lbs initially, then increase to 49 ft-lbs, followed by a final angle torque of 90 degrees. Why so complicated? This method ensures even pressure distribution across the cylinder head, preventing leaks and maintaining optimal engine performance. Another critical area is the connecting rod bolts. These bolts hold the connecting rods to the crankshaft and are subjected to immense stress during engine operation. The torque spec for these bolts is typically around 29 ft-lbs. Again, refer to your service manual for the precise value and any specific tightening procedures. The main bearing cap bolts also play a crucial role in keeping the crankshaft in place. These are usually torqued to around 56 ft-lbs. These bolts support the crankshaft, and proper torque ensures the crankshaft rotates smoothly and efficiently. Ignoring these specs can lead to catastrophic engine failure, so always double-check your manual. Lastly, don't forget about the spark plugs. Over-tightening spark plugs can damage the threads in the cylinder head, while under-tightening can lead to leaks and poor engine performance. The torque spec for spark plugs is usually quite low, around 13 ft-lbs. A torque wrench is your best friend here, preventing costly mistakes. Remember, these are just examples, and the actual torque specs may vary slightly. Always consult your repair manual for the most accurate information for your specific engine.
Chassis and Suspension Torque Specifications
Moving on to the chassis and suspension, these components are crucial for handling and safety. Proper torque ensures that everything stays connected and functions as it should. Let's start with the lug nuts. These are probably the most frequently torqued fasteners on your car, especially if you're swapping wheels or tires. The recommended torque for lug nuts on a 2000 Honda Civic EX is typically around 80 ft-lbs. Always use a torque wrench to ensure proper tightening and follow a star pattern to evenly distribute the load. Over-tightening lug nuts can warp the brake rotors or strip the threads on the wheel studs, while under-tightening can cause the wheels to come loose – a very dangerous situation. The suspension components also have specific torque requirements. The strut assembly bolts, for example, need to be properly torqued to ensure the suspension functions correctly and the vehicle handles as it should. The torque spec for these bolts can vary, but it's generally in the range of 40-70 ft-lbs. Check your manual for the exact value. Similarly, the lower control arm bolts and ball joint nuts need to be tightened to the specified torque to maintain proper suspension geometry and prevent premature wear. These are typically torqued to around 50-80 ft-lbs, depending on the specific component. Don't forget about the tie rod ends. These connect the steering rack to the wheels and are crucial for steering accuracy. The torque spec for the tie rod end nuts is usually around 30-40 ft-lbs. Improperly torqued tie rod ends can lead to play in the steering and affect the vehicle's alignment. Finally, the brake caliper bolts also require proper torque to ensure the brakes function safely. These are usually torqued to around 25-35 ft-lbs. Over-tightening can damage the caliper or rotor, while under-tightening can cause the caliper to come loose, leading to brake failure. As with all torque specs, always refer to your repair manual for the most accurate information. Getting these values right ensures a safe and comfortable ride.
Transmission Torque Specifications
The transmission is another critical area where proper torque is essential. Whether you have a manual or automatic transmission, ensuring all bolts are tightened to the correct specification can prevent leaks and ensure smooth operation. For the transmission mount bolts, the torque spec is typically around 40-50 ft-lbs. These mounts secure the transmission to the chassis and absorb vibrations. Over-tightening can damage the mounts, while under-tightening can cause excessive movement and vibration. The transmission drain plug and fill plug also have specific torque requirements. Over-tightening these plugs can damage the threads in the transmission case, while under-tightening can lead to leaks. The torque spec for these plugs is usually quite low, around 25-30 ft-lbs. A torque wrench is highly recommended to avoid any issues. If you're working on the transmission case bolts, make sure to follow the recommended torque sequence and values. These bolts hold the transmission case together, and proper torque ensures a tight seal and prevents leaks. The torque spec for these bolts is typically around 20-30 ft-lbs. The shift linkage bolts on a manual transmission also require proper torque. These bolts connect the shift linkage to the transmission and allow you to select gears. The torque spec for these bolts is usually around 15-20 ft-lbs. Improperly torqued shift linkage bolts can lead to sloppy shifting or difficulty selecting gears. Why are Torque Specs Important?
You might be wondering, why all the fuss about torque specs? Well, proper torque is essential for several reasons. First and foremost, it ensures the safety of you and your passengers. Properly tightened fasteners prevent parts from coming loose and causing accidents. Secondly, it prevents damage to your vehicle. Over-tightening can strip threads, warp components, or break bolts, while under-tightening can cause parts to wear prematurely or fail altogether. Thirdly, it ensures proper performance. Components that are not torqued to the correct specification may not function as intended, leading to poor handling, reduced braking performance, or engine problems. Finally, following torque specs prolongs the life of your vehicle. By ensuring everything is tightened properly, you can prevent premature wear and tear and keep your Civic EX running smoothly for years to come. Tools You'll Need
Before you start wrenching on your 2000 Honda Civic EX, make sure you have the right tools for the job. The most important tool is a torque wrench. This allows you to accurately measure the amount of torque you're applying to a fastener. There are two main types of torque wrenches: click-type and digital. Click-type torque wrenches are more common and affordable, while digital torque wrenches offer greater accuracy and features. You'll also need a socket set with various sizes to fit the different fasteners on your car. Make sure to use high-quality sockets to avoid rounding off the bolt heads. A repair manual is also essential. This will provide you with the specific torque specs for your vehicle, as well as detailed instructions for various repair procedures. A breaker bar can be helpful for loosening stubborn bolts. This provides extra leverage to break the bolt free. Penetrating oil can also be useful for loosening corroded bolts. Apply it to the threads and let it soak for a few minutes before attempting to remove the bolt. Finally, a good set of wrenches is always a must-have for any DIY mechanic. You'll need various sizes to fit the different fasteners on your car. With the right tools and knowledge, you can tackle many repairs on your 2000 Honda Civic EX and save yourself some money.
